A messy scene unfolded during a cricket match between Bangladesh and South Africa in Dhaka. While Bangladesh was batting, things got heated when Ripon Mondol, a 22-year-old batter, had a confrontation with 29-year-old South African bowler Tshepo Ntuli. What started as some intense looks soon escalated into a brawl on the pitch, pulling in players from both teams.

The trouble began after Ripon hit a big six off Ntuli’s bowling, which clearly upset the bowler. As Ripon turned to head back to his partner, Ntuli rushed at him. They shoved each other, and things quickly spiraled into a full-blown fight. Despite umpire Kamruzzaman trying to step in, Ntuli yanked Ripon’s helmet multiple times. A few South African players also got involved.

There’s no word yet if any trash talk preceded the fight. Just three balls later, Ntuli threw the ball back at Ripon, who managed to deflect it.

This is extreme, this is not right. While we usually see some arguing on the field, this kind of fight is rare, said commentator Nabil Kaiser, as noted by ESPNcricinfo. The match referee will be sending reports about the incident to both cricket boards, and some action is expected to follow.
